A MySQL benchmarking tool
This benchmark was designed for identifying basic system parameters, as
they are important for systems using MySQL (w Innodb) under intensive
load.

- Update to version 1.0.8: * fixed api_report test for slow machines (thanks to @jcfp) * fileio: suggest to run prepare step on missing files (thanks to Heinrich Schuchardt) * JSON reports: removed an erroneous trailing comma (GH-139) * added events per second to the CPU benchmark report (GH-140) * fixed db_connect() in legacy SQL API to use the default value for --db-driver (GH-146) * removed busy-wait in the bounded event generation mode (--rate) to avoid CPU hogging
